#f283c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f283c2 is composed of 94.9% red, 51.4%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 45.9% magenta, 19.8%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 325.9 degrees, a saturation of 81% and a lightness of 73.1%. #f283c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#e50785. Closest websafe color is: #ff99cc.

#f283c2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f283c2 has RGB values of R:242, G:131,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.2,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15893442.

Shades and Tints of #f283c2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fdeef6 is the lightest one.
